2017-08-10 181 views
-1

假設我在單元格A1中有一個數字。我想這樣做,如果我在單元格A2中寫入一個數字,它將在A1中添加,然後在A2中清除。我怎麼做?如何將數字添加到單元格,將其添加到其他單元格中,然後清除

+0

您需要在VBA中添加一些代碼。 –

+0

我找到了那部分。我想知道該寫什麼,因爲.gs的文檔有點含糊,我不知道如何做簡單的事情,比如選擇單元格值,存儲在一個臨時變量中,並寫入另一個單元格。 – user3231631

回答

0

試試這個VBA代碼,

Private Sub worksheet_change(ByVal target As Range) 
If target.Address = "$A$2" And IsNumeric(Cells(1, 1)) And IsNumeric(Cells(2, 1)) Then 
    Cells(1, 1) = Cells(1, 1) + Cells(2, 1) 
    Cells(2, 1).ClearContents 
End If 
End Sub 

該代碼將在A1A2值,存儲在A1新值,只要在單元格中輸入一個新值就可以清除細胞A2數據。

相關問題